Abstract

See full text

A ball vibrator, which generates a vibration caused by a centrifugal force accompanied by a rotation of a non-magnetic ball in a circumferential direction thereof around a center point thereof, is disposed in contact with a prescribed portion of a subject of which an image is produced. Then, a magnetic resonance elastogram (MRE) pulse sequence is employed for the subject and the vibration from the ball vibrator is used to produce a magnetic resonance elastogram (MRE).
